Voting is over. The polls have closed for the 40th annual Best of Chico. What has endured as a favorite community event all started back in 1985 as a single-page ballot in our weekly print edition of the CN&R. Readers would hand-write their choices on the newsprint page and mail them back in, or submit them in person at our downtown office. As more categories were added, the contest grew each year without interruption, except for the year 2020 when life was put on hold during the pandemic shutdown.

When our weekly News & Review issues became available online in 2001, simultaneously with the print version, it also became easier to review previous Best of Chico issues. By 2005 a special tab was created on our website so you can go directly to those issues in the Best of Chico Archives.

So today, no more paper ballots as all voting is done online, making tabulation more efficient and accurate. We still have human eyes go through all the results looking for any quirks, especially in the first round of nominations that ended on May 23 and where voters could write in any response to a particular category. We always see some odd business nominations by some voters who were either not focused on the actual category, got distracted after typing a few letters, were being witty or were just messing with us.
